Настройка интегрированной среды разработки в Visual Studio для Mac

Внимание

Visual Studio для Mac планируется выйти на пенсию 31 августа 2024 г. в соответствии с корпорацией Майкрософт Современная политика жизненного цикла. Хотя вы можете продолжать работать с Visual Studio для Mac, есть несколько других вариантов для разработчиков на Mac, таких как предварительная версия нового расширения комплекта разработки C# для VS Code.

Дополнительные сведения о поддержке временная шкала и альтернативах.

Visual Studio для Mac можно настраивать, что позволяет пользователям разрабатывать приложения в среде, которая соответствует их требованиям к эффективности и внешнему виду. В этой статье рассматриваются разные способы адаптации Visual Studio для Mac под конкретные потребности.

Темная тема

Dark Theme View

Вы можете переключать темы в Visual Studio для Mac, перейдя в визуальный стиль среды > параметров > Visual Studio > и выбрав нужную тему из раскрывающегося списка темы пользовательского интерфейса, как показано на следующем рисунке:

Dark Theme Selection

Локализация

Система Visual Studio для Mac локализована на следующие 14 языков, что делает ее доступной большему числу разработчиков.

  • Китайский — Китай
  • Китайский (Тайвань)
  • чешский
  • французский
  • немецкий
  • Английский
  • Итальянский
  • Японский
  • Корейский
  • Польский
  • Португальский — Бразилия
  • русский
  • Испанский
  • Турецкий

Чтобы изменить язык, отображаемый Visual Studio для Mac, перейдите в visual Studio > Preferences > Environment > Visual Style и выберите нужный язык в раскрывающемся списке "Язык пользовательского интерфейса", как показано на следующем рисунке:

Language Selection

Сведения об авторе

Панель сведений об авторе позволяет добавлять соответствующие сведения о себе, например имя, адрес электронной почты, владельца авторских прав на вашу работу, вашу организацию и товарный знак:

Edit Author Information section

Эта информация используется для заполнения стандартных заголовков файлов, например лицензии, которые можно добавить в новые файлы:

Standard Header options

Заполненные поля Имя и Электронная почта будут использоваться в любой фиксации, осуществляемой через систему управления версиями в Visual Studio для Mac. Если вы не заполнили эти поля, Visual Studio для Mac предложит сделать это при попытке воспользоваться системой управления версиями.

Сочетания клавиш

Настраиваемые сочетания клавиш позволяют адаптировать среду разработки, чтобы повысить эффективность навигации по Visual Studio для Mac. Эта среда предоставляет привычные сочетания клавиш для многих популярных интегрированных сред разработки, таких как Visual Studio (в Windows), ReSharper, Visual Studio Code и Xcode.

Настраиваемые сочетания клавиш можно задать, перейдя в раздел Visual Studio > Параметры > Окружение > Настраиваемые сочетания клавиш, как показано на следующем изображении.

Set Key bindings

В нем вы можете искать сочетания клавиш, просматривать конфликтующие сочетания, добавлять новые и изменять существующие сочетания клавиш.

Эти сочетания можно также задать во время начальной настройки Visual Studio для Mac с помощью экрана выбора клавиатуры:

Set Key bindings, first run

Макет рабочей области

Рабочая область Visual Studio для Mac состоит из основной области документа (обычно это редактор, область конструктора или файл параметров), окруженной дополнительными окнами инструментов. Они содержат полезные сведения для доступа к файлам приложения, тестам и отладке и управления ими.

Workspace layout

Просмотр и упорядочение окон инструментов

При открытии в Visual Studio для Mac любого нового файла или решения вы можете заметить в рабочей области несколько окон инструментов: "Окно решения", "Структура документа" и "Ошибки".

Tool window

Visual Studio для Mac предоставляет окна инструментов с дополнительными сведениями, инструментами и функциями навигации, доступ к которым можно получить, перейдя к элементу меню Вид и выбрав окно инструментов, чтобы добавить его.

Select new tool window

Окна инструментов также могут быть автоматически открыты различными командами, такими как команда "Найти в файлах " (SHIFT+ CMD+ F), которая открывает отсоединяемое окно результатов поиска.

Окна инструментов можно перемещать и упорядочивать по всему рабочему процессу независимо от того, как вам удобнее всего. Например, их можно закрепить с любой стороны редактора документов, рядом с другим окном инструментов, выше или ниже его либо в виде набора окон с вкладками, что позволяет быстро переключаться между ними.

Часто используемые окна инструментов можно полностью отсоединить от окна Visual Studio для Mac, создав для них отдельные окна.

Окна инструментов можно закрепить и закрыть элементами управления в правом верхнем углу каждого окна:

Using controls to pin or close tool windows

Закрепленные окна закрепляются к сторонам рабочей области и остаются открытыми для более быстрого доступа. Незакрепленные окна закреплены, но отображаются только после наведения указателя мыши на вкладку для окна или использования для этого клавиатуры. Они могут быть скрыты после потери фокуса мыши или клавиатуры.

Упорядочение макетов

Постоянно отображаемые окна инструментов зависят от текущего контекста. Например, при использовании визуального конструктора наиболее важны окна элементов и свойств, а при отладке удобно использовать окна отладчика для просмотра стека и локальных переменных.

Состояние открытых окон представлено макетом. Макеты можно переключать вручную с помощью меню "Вид", как показано на следующем рисунке. Они также переключаются автоматически при выполнении действия, например, при отладке или при открытии раскадровки:

Selecting new layouts

Можно создать макет, выбрав Вид > Макет > Сохранить текущий макет… При этом текущий макет добавляется в меню, чтобы его можно было выбрать в любое время:

Save current layout

Поддержка параллельного редактирования

Visual Studio для Mac позволяет открыть текстовые редакторы рядом либо использовать редактор в виде отсоединенного перемещаемого окна.

Режим двух столбцов можно включить, выбрав Вид > Столбцы редактора > 2 столбца либо перетащив вкладку редактора к одной из границ области редактора.

Two column side-by-side mode

Вкладки редактора можно перетаскивать из области документа, чтобы создать перемещаемое окно редактора. Это окно также поддерживает расположенные рядом редакторы и может содержать несколько вкладок редактора:

Create new window

Two columns side by side with additional tabs

Чтобы вернуться к одному открытому редактору, выберите Вид > Столбцы редактора > 1 столбец.

См. также